HECO's emergency demand response program would encourage customers to install solar and battery systems that the utility could draw on during periods of tight energy supplies.
Hawaii's PUC OK'd HECO's plan to create an emergency DR program to help cover the expected energy shortfall caused by the shutdown of Oahu's AES plant.
